McNay Art Museum: An Introduction surveys the founder, history, architecture and collection of the San Antonio, Texas, museum of modern and contemporary art. Opened in 1954, four years after the death of artist, educator, and collector Marion Koogler McNay, the museum's founder, the McNay grew from a collection of a few hundred works of art to nearly 20,000 objects. The collection focuses on European and American art from the mid-19th century to the present. Originally housed in Marion McNay's Spanish Colonial Revival residence, addition of the Stieren Center for Exhibitions doubled the museum's facilities. This handbook tells the story of the founder of the museum, examines its architecture and growth, and surveys the collection through text and images. Key works of art illustrate the range of paintings, sculpture, and works on paper, including an outstanding collection of theatre arts with designs for opera, ballet, and the stage. Most Tim Burton films are huge box-office successes, and several are already classics. The director's mysterious and eccentric public persona attracts a lot of attention, while the films themselves have been somewhat overlooked. Here, Alison McMahan redresses this imbalance through a close analysis of Burton's key films () and their industrial context. She argues that Burton has been a crucial figure behind many of the transformations taking place in horror, fantasy, and sci-fi films over the last two decades, and demonstrates how his own work draws on a huge range of artistic influences: the films of George Melies, surrealism, installation art, computer games, and many more. The Films of Tim Burton is the most in-depth analysis so far of the work of this unusual filmmaker - a director who has shown repeatedly that it is possible to reject mainstream Hollywood contentions while maintaining critical popularrity and commercial success.
